  • GOOD PRODUCT, WELL DESIGNED, BUT...
Did nothing for my printer. But I don't think the problem is a clogged print head. I used the whole bottle, warmed up as instructed. Black print head flushed out completely. Pretty neat how the liquid sprays out of the print head like a ribbon. Flushed completely until the outflow was completely clear, no trace of ink. Still getting same result--test prints have ZERO black. Not even smudging or faded print--It's just a clean white sheet of paper with only the Cyan and Yellow bands. My magenta is not printing either. Since I had no cleaner left, I flushed the nozzle for magenta on the color print head, using just air pressure. Forced out all the magenta until none left. Before all this, I filled all my ink levels to the max. Also tried all the cleaning option utilities. FLUSH option used ONE FOURTH of my inks. Ink tubes inside are completely filled, the black and the colors. Have done several resets, test patterns, even documents. Absolutely NO black, no text. Just a clean white sheet of paper, no smudges. NADA. I'm sure this is a great product but apparently clogged head isn't my issue. THIS IS WHY I DIDN'T RATE ANY FEATURES. Had to give an overall rating but gave 4 stars only because I don't know how it would have done if I did have a clogged print head. I guess I'll buy a new Canon G6020. This one lasted me only 2 years, and I rarely used it. ... show more

  • It works but…
We had two printers that needed to be cleaned. One printer was the Brother MFC-J835DW and an Epson XP-446. After watching the video on how to clean the printers, both printers printing issue did not resolve. For the Brother, the black ink still would not print. After examining the line, we noticed the black ink was not flowing at all, as if there was no seal allowing the ink to flow through the line. The colored ink flowed freely and printed with no issue. For the Epson, we got it to print but the print head was causing it to smear the colored ink then all of a sudden the printer shut down and would not turn back on. Both printers we have to recycle now. The solution does work, but beware it may not resolve the issue at all. The only way you can fully clean the print head is to remove the print head and flush the fluid through it, if possible. I think the print head was damaged after cleaning it on the Epson printer due to it rubbing against the paper towel, hence the smeared ink when printing. The cost for the actual product is too high. You get everything you need, but the bottle of solution is enough to clean just one printer one time. I would not attempt to clean the printer, but just buy a new one. ... show more
